Spanning over 300 years, Homegoing tells the story of two half-sisters in Ghana—one sold into slavery, the other married to a colonizer. Their descendants’ journeys stretch from Africa to America, exposing the scars of history. Yaa Gyasi’s debut is both emotional and illuminating.
